If you have an idea where she is, you could appeal to her curiosity.
When Annie is hiding outside and threatening not to come in, Ade and I
pretend that we've found something really interesting in the kitchen,
or in the middle of the lawn. A few rounds of "Have you seen this?
It's a shame Annie can't see it, she'd love it." usually brings her
across, then we can scoop her up. Of course, the neighbours think
we're daft.

It is too bad that Smudgie is not friendly with dogs and won't stick
around when Kylie and Roxie approach her. However, on thinking of that
I remembered something from long, long ago. My RB dog Snowball loved
cats, although most of them didn't reciprocate of course. A cat
belonging to a lady in our building got loose and we all KNEW where
she was hanging out but no one could get close enough to catch her.

However, Snowball and I got on one side of the yard she was in and
started toward her. So, as always, she jumped the fence. And there,
waiting to catch her were her mommy and another lady who lived in the
building. They still had trouble catching her but they did catch her.
And once she was back in the apartment she quickly lost the fear that
had apparently kept her from recognizing her mommy.
